`

JS操作table

阅读更多
一。插入行:
function insRow(){
	var x=document.getElementById('myTable').insertRow(0)
	//为新增行添加class
	//x.setAttribte("class","css");
	var y=x.insertCell(0)
	var z=x.insertCell(1)
	y.innerHTML="NEW CELL1"
	z.innerHTML="NEW CELL2"
}



二。删除行:
function deleteRow(r){
	var i=r.parentNode.parentNode.rowIndex
	document.getElementById('myTable').deleteRow(i)
}



三。得到行号:
onclick="hh(this)",onclick事件触发table中的行
function hh(obj){
	var hh=obj.parentNode.parentNode.rowIndex;
}



四。得到列数:
document.getElementById('myTable').rows[hh].cells.length;
0
0
分享到:
评论

相关推荐

Global site tag (gtag.js) - Google Analytics